What you’ll do
* Your week normally starts with a team meeting on Monday to set you up for success.
* Most of your time will be spent with customers, learning about their fleets and operations, and identifying how we can solve their challenges.
* Approximately 80% of your time will be with end users, 18% with key dealers, and 2% with OE dealers.
* You’ll be hands-on with vehicles, come rain or shine.
* Ensuring your calls are recorded in Sales Force.
* Depending on your targeted workload, there may be some overnight stays and occasionally, you might work on weekends to capture key fleet information that will help build your success within the role (though it’s not compulsory).
* We’ll provide thorough training on everything from technical details to sales skills, and we’ll ensure you have all the support and tools you need to succeed.
